Position Summary
The Material’s Coordinator will collaborate with all departments to ensure efficient flow of all orders through shipping. The Material Coordinator will have an important role in final quality check of orders prior to being shipped. The ideal candidate will possess a high attention to detail, be very thorough in work quality, be able to identify inefficiencies, and effectively communicate suggestions to supervision. This position will work 2nd shift Monday through Friday, 2:45 pm to 11:15 pm and every third Saturday.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ities include but not limited to:

- Effectively coordinate the movement of orders through the shop from start to completion by communicating with shift leads and supervisors in each department for order status.
- Maintain all information regarding order status and provide updates to management as needed.
- Perform quality checks as orders flow through departments. Work with operators and shift leads to ensure accountability of all materials for an order.
- Conduct final quality check of orders, before shipping to ensure the order is to the customers standards and expectations.
- Complete Quality Problem Reports when necessary.
- Wrap and prepare orders to ship.
- Load and Unload furnace when needed.
- Other duties assigned.

Requirements
Qualifications and Requirements
- Ability to read and comprehend instructions, correspondence, memos, and order slips
- Ability to write clearly and send simple correspondence
- Knowledge of basic computer functions to send emails, or enter data
- Able to communicate verbal and written with other employees and supervisors
- Apply common sense understanding to solving problems
- Critical thinking skills and attention to detail
Education and Experience
- High school diploma or GED
- 1-2 years’ experience as a material handler or similar position
- Experienced forklift operator
Work Environment and Physical Demands
The following environment/atmospheric working conditions are commonly, but not always, associated with the performance of this position.
- The noise level in the working environment is loud and is not climate controlled. Employee must be able to work in extreme hot or cold weather. Ability to lift to 50lbs. Frequent standing, bending, and kneeling are mandatory in order to successfully perform work duties.
